Back to jobs
Aardvark Swift are supporting the fantastic Flying Wild Hog in their search for a Network/Multiplayer Programmer.
As a Network/Multiplayer Programmer, you will prototype, develop and maintain network and multiplayer systems in the project. You might also work on server orchestration, performance optimization, live metrics, etc. The project's scope is wide, so you will be able to specialize in your preferred area.
Your roles and responsibilities...
The skills and experience you'll need...
Bonus points if you have...
Perks and Benefits...
Network Programmer - Krakow, PL
- Posted 09 August 2022
- Salary Negotiable
- LocationKraków
- Job type Permanent
- DisciplineProgramming
- Reference17819
- Contact NamePaul Walker
Job description
Network Programmer
Flying Wild Hog - Krakow, PL
Aardvark Swift are supporting the fantastic Flying Wild Hog in their search for a Network/Multiplayer Programmer.
As a Network/Multiplayer Programmer, you will prototype, develop and maintain network and multiplayer systems in the project. You might also work on server orchestration, performance optimization, live metrics, etc. The project's scope is wide, so you will be able to specialize in your preferred area.
Your roles and responsibilities...
- Developing and maintaining gameplay systems related to networking and multiplayer in a client-server architecture (both on server and client)
- Working on player matchmaking, server orchestration, and autoscaling
- Debugging and optimizing network systems for optimal latency and bandwidth utilization
- Coordinating multi-region and multi-environment game server deployments
- Maintaining and improving backend performance monitoring and alerting systems
- Adapting third-party tools, libraries, and APIs for networking
The skills and experience you'll need...
- 3 years of experience developing server architecture and applications for online games
- Deep understanding of client-server and P2P architecture, scalability, and security considerations
- Practical knowledge of game backends
- Understanding of low-level network APIs
- Good Unreal Engine 4 knowledge
- Strong C++ knowledge
Bonus points if you have...
- Familiarity with Gamelift, k8s, and Go
- Experience with matchmaking systems
- Experience with multiplayer on Xbox/PS consoles
Perks and Benefits...
- Private medical care (entirely financed by the employer)
- Fitprofit card
- Working environment based on a strong team spirit and positive energy
- Salary depending on skill level and experience
- Influence on various aspects of the game - the game is being created by the whole team
- The team consisting of experienced experts, that means - huge development possibilities
- Really flexible working hours (core hours 11:00-16:00)